Masahiro Miyao - Bizen Guinomi

13,200 YEN
Sold out

size : W6.8cm×6.9cm×H5.7cm

He presents his work in two ways: traditional Bizen ware style and black style.
This Guinomi is made in black style.
It is a technique to apply mud containing a small amount of cobalt, which has been popular since 2000.
Black-style pieces have a beautiful black clay color that is roughly glossy and a bright cobalt blue fire pattern.
However, in this Guinomi, the black is almost completely transformed into indigo, which is very strange.
The black color is still present in the base, and in the areas where the clay is thin, a beautiful black color can be seen.

Yuho Kaneshige - Imbe Guinomi

49,500 YEN
Sold out

size : W6.7cm×6.5cm×H5.1cm

Yuho Kaneshige is the third son of Sozan Kaneshige.
He inherited Inbe's house and kiln from his father.
He was presenting traditional Kaneshige style works.
But around 2018 he started a new challenge.
He demolished the kiln that he inherited from his father and made a more primitive kiln.
This Guinomi is a work that was fired in its primitive kiln.
This Guinomi features both elegant colors of the Kaneshige style and strong colors of old Bizen.
This Guinomi was fired in July 2023.



Ken Fujiwara - Bizen Bajohai

50,000 YEN
Sold out

size : W6.8cm×6.7cm×H6.0cm

This Guinomi was made by Ken Fujiwara before 1970.
He made a large kiln in 1970, this Bajohai was fired in Noborigama kiln.
Goma and Sangiri are occurring in a balanced manner.
A subtle Hidasuki hangs on the inside, showing his great sense of aesthetics.
Bajohai was inspired by the cup shape used by Mongolians on horseback.

Koji Nakahara - Bizen Susogo Kinsai Guinomi

12,100 YEN
Sold out

size : W6.8cm×6.5cm×H6.7cm

Koji Nakahara is a potter who works in two places, Osaka and Bizen.
He is commissioned to make bespoke tableware by a famous restaurant in Osaka.
And in Bizen, he is learning about Bizen ware from his teacher, Fumio Kawabata.
He uses an electric kiln to turn Hidasuki into a metallic color.
Susogo is a word used to dye clothes.
He named it because the gradation from pink gold to dark gray is similar.
